What Are the Essential Yoga Poses for Absolute Beginners?

Before diving into complex sequences, it’s wise to master a few foundational poses. These will build your confidence, improve your alignment, and prevent injury. Let’s start with the basics:

  • Mountain Pose (Tadasana): This is the foundation of all standing poses. It improves posture, balance, and body awareness.
  • Downward-Facing Dog (Adho Mukha Svanasana): A classic pose that stretches the entire body while strengthening the arms and legs.
  • Child’s Pose (Balasana): A deeply relaxing rest pose that calms the mind and releases tension in the back and hips.
  • Warrior I (Virabhadrasana I): A powerful standing pose that builds strength and confidence in the legs and core.
  • Tree Pose (Vrksasana): A balancing pose that improves focus, stability, and concentration.
  • Corpse Pose (Savasana): The ultimate relaxation pose, essential for integrating the benefits of your practice.

Remember, your body is unique, and every practice is a journey. Therefore, listen to your body, honor its limits, and never force a stretch. Over time, your flexibility and strength will naturally improve, and these poses will feel more comfortable and accessible.

How to Meditate for Beginners: A Simple 5-Minute Guide

Meditation might seem intimidating, but it’s actually wonderfully simple. The goal is not to empty your mind, but rather to notice your thoughts without judgment and gently return your attention to the present moment. Here’s a straightforward method to begin:

  1. Find a quiet spot where you won’t be disturbed. Sit comfortably, either on a cushion or a chair, with your spine tall but relaxed.
  2. Close your eyes and take a few deep breaths. Let your shoulders drop and release any tension in your jaw.
  3. Focus on your breath, noticing the natural rhythm of your inhales and exhales. If your mind wanders, that’s perfectly okay—simply bring it back with kindness.
  4. Set a gentle timer for five minutes. As you become more comfortable, you can gradually extend your sessions.

That’s it! Consistency matters far more than duration. Therefore, even a five-minute daily practice can create profound shifts in your mental state and overall well-being.

How to Build a Sustainable Daily Yoga Routine?

One of the biggest challenges beginners face is staying motivated. However, building a sustainable routine is easier than you might think if you approach it strategically. Here are some practical tips:

  • Start small: Commit to just 10–15 minutes a day. This removes the pressure and makes it easy to show up consistently.
  • Choose a consistent time: Whether it’s morning or evening, anchoring your practice to a specific time helps form a habit.
  • Create a dedicated space: A corner of your room with a mat, cushion, and perhaps a candle can make your practice feel special.
  • Track your progress: Noticing small improvements keeps you inspired and engaged.
  • Be kind to yourself: Some days will feel harder than others. What matters is that you keep showing up.

What Are Common Mistakes Beginners Make in Yoga?

Even the most dedicated beginners make mistakes, and that’s all part of the learning process. However, knowing what to watch out for can help you progress more smoothly. Here are some of the most common pitfalls:

  • Pushing too hard: Yoga is not about forcing your body into a pose. Respect your limits and allow your practice to unfold naturally.
  • Inconsistent practice: Sporadic sessions yield fewer benefits than a short, consistent routine.
  • Skipping the warm-up: Always warm up your body to prevent strain and injury.
  • Comparing yourself to others: Your practice is uniquely yours. Comparison only steals your joy.
  • Ignoring your breath: Your breath is your anchor. If you’re holding it, you’re likely pushing too hard.

By keeping these principles in mind, you’ll build a practice that is safe, enjoyable, and deeply rewarding.

Frequently Asked Questions About Yoga for Beginners

How often should a beginner practice yoga?

For beginners, practicing two to three times per week is a great starting point. This allows your body to recover while still building a solid foundation. As you become more comfortable, you can gradually increase the frequency to five or six days a week if it feels right for you.

Do I need any special equipment to start yoga?

Not at all! A non-slip yoga mat is helpful, but you can even practice on a carpet or towel. Comfortable clothing that allows movement is also recommended. Everything else is optional and can be added as you progress.

How long until I see results from yoga and meditation?

Many people notice improvements in flexibility and mood within just a few weeks of consistent practice. However, deeper changes—such as improved focus and emotional resilience—tend to build over several months. Remember, this is a journey, not a race.

Can I practice yoga if I’m not flexible?

Absolutely! Flexibility is the result of practice, not a prerequisite. Yoga meets you exactly where you are, and every session gently helps you open up over time.

Is meditation suitable for beginners?

Yes, and it’s one of the most accessible practices you can adopt. Starting with just five minutes a day is more than enough to experience meaningful benefits. Consistency truly is the key.
